There are 600 acres in Iredell County that will soon become the newest addition to the Girl Scout properties in western North Carolina. Girl Scouts, Hornets’ Nest council is in the process of selling its existing camps to purchase 600 acres of undeveloped land, but in 2009 it will become the property of the new, merged western North Carolina council, belonging to and serving all the girls in the region. North Carolina Outward Bound

Girl Scouts of WNC ages 14-18 may now sign up for the North Carolina Outward Bound program. Outward Bound maintains three base camps in Western North Carolina. The school uses camping, orienteering, rock climbing, whitewater canoeing and other outdoor experiences to teach resourcefulness, group cooperation, leadership, and personal self-confidence.
